Magic Hour
by Greg Yasinitsky

Casting tenor sax in the solo spotlight, this slow funk tribute to the late, great Grover Washington features a catchy, 16th-note groove, hip changes, and solid ensemble writing. Driven by a heavy backbeat supplied by bass and drums, figures appear harder than they are. The chart ends dramatically with an optional solo cadenza and fill. Written solo lines and a guitar chord chart are included, and it's playable by 9-17 pieces.
Grade: Medium
Style: SLOW 16TH-NOTE FUNK
Ranges: G5 trumpet, Bb3 trombone
Solos: written or ad lib tenor sax
Rhythm Section: rhythm section parts notated with chords cued
Instrumentation: playable by 9-17 pieces
